How to sort hashset in java
WebVarious methods of Java HashSet class are as follows: Java HashSet Example Let's see a simple example of HashSet. Notice, the elements iterate in an unordered collection. import java.util.*; class HashSet1 { public static void main (String args []) { //Creating HashSet and adding elements HashSet set=new HashSet (); set.add ("One"); WebMar 6, 2024 · When retrieving a value from the HashMap, the key is first hashed to an index in the array. The linked list at that index is then traversed to find the key-value pair with the specified key. If the key is not found in the linked list, then the value associated with the key is not in the HashMap.
How to sort hashset in java
Did you know?
WebThis class permits the null element. This class offers constant time performance for the basic operations ( add, remove, contains and size ), assuming the hash function disperses … WebMar 25, 2024 · The TreeSet will automatically sort its elements in ascending order. Method 2: Convert HashSet to List and Sort with Collections.sort() To sort a HashSet in Java, you …
WebMay 16, 2024 · Thus, in order to sort a HashSet you can either- Convert HashSet to a list and then sort that List by using Collections.sort () method. One drawback of using this option to sort a HashSet is that you get the result as list. Create a TreeSet by passing the HashSet, it will automatically be sorted. WebMar 18, 2024 · We can sort a HashSet in Java. HashSet elements are not sorted originally as it does not maintain the order of elements. We can follow two approaches to sort a HashSet in Java. Using Collections.sort () Method In this approach, we convert the HashSet into a list. Then, we use the Collections.sort () method to sort the list.
WebIn this post, we will see how to sort HashSet in java. HashSet is a collection which does not store elements in any order. You might come across a situation where you need to sort … WebNov 5, 2024 · Hence sorting of HashSet is not possible. However, the elements of the HashSet can be sorted indirectly by converting into List or TreeSet, but this will keep the elements in the target type instead of HashSet type. Below is the implementation of the … How to sort HashSet in Java; How to Loop Over TreeSet in Java? Difference …
WebApr 13, 2024 · Array can be a source of a Stream or Array can be created from the existing array or of a part of an array: // Array can also be a source of a Stream. Stream streamOfArray = Stream.of ("a", "b", "c"); streamOfArray.forEach (System.out::println); Creating Stream object from String using chars () method.
WebSep 20, 2024 · Following is the code to sort HashSet in Java − Example import java.util.*; public class Main { public static void main(String args[]) { Set hashSet = new … bing maps bucharestWebHere is a simple Java program that attempts to sort a HashSet first by converting it into List and also by using TreeSet, which is your sorted set. I have first created a HashSet of String and stored a couple of names in arbitrary order. Later I have printed the HashSet to show that elements are not stored in any order. d2aw-c072hWebDec 1, 2024 · No guarantee is made as to the iteration order of the set which means when we iterate the HashSet, there is no guarantee that we get elements in which order they … bing maps app for officeWebFor example, to add items to it, use the add () method: Example Get your own Java Server. import java.util.HashSet; public class Main { public static void main(String[] args) { … d2 assembly\\u0027sWebTo sort and HashSet there are several methods like convert HashSet to TreeSet or sort () method of Collections class or using sorted () method of the stream. Since HashSet does not guarantee insertion order and does not store elements in sorting order then Java provides TreeSet to store sorted data. Time for an Example: d2aw-c073hWebList一.Collections排序方法Vector的使用如下:ArrayList使用方法ArrayList LinkedList VectorArrayListLinkedList特点常用方法二、集合:HashSet二元组:HashMap四、使用技巧Collections中sort方法Comparator的重写一.Collections 继承于Coll… bing maps business portalWebJan 4,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. d2aw-c073mr-046